
Excel表格自动调整行高的步骤包括:使用自动调整功能、手动设置固定行高、利用公式调整行高。 在这些方法中,使用自动调整功能是最常见且便捷的方式,它能根据单元格内容自动调整行高,确保内容完全显示。以下将详细介绍这些方法及其应用场景。
一、使用自动调整功能
1、选择需要调整的行
首先,打开你的Excel文件,选择你需要调整行高的行。你可以点击行号,按住鼠标左键拖动选择多个行,或者按住Ctrl键逐行选择。
2、使用自动调整行高功能
在选择了需要调整的行后,右键点击所选行的行号,然后在弹出的菜单中选择“行高自动调整”或“适应行高”选项。这将使Excel自动根据每个单元格中的内容调整行高,确保内容能够完全显示。这一功能在处理包含大量文本的单元格时尤其有用。
二、手动设置固定行高
1、选择需要调整的行
同样,首先选择你需要调整行高的行。
2、设置固定行高
右键点击所选行的行号,在弹出的菜单中选择“行高”选项。在弹出的对话框中,你可以手动输入一个固定的行高值(例如:6),然后点击“确定”。这种方法适用于需要统一调整行高的场景。
三、利用公式调整行高
1、使用VBA宏实现动态调整
对于需要根据特定条件自动调整行高的复杂场景,可以使用VBA(Visual Basic for Applications)宏来实现。打开Excel的VBA编辑器,输入以下代码:
Sub AdjustRowHeight()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im cell As Range
For Each cell In ws.UsedRange
If cell.Value <> "" Then
cell.Rows.AutoFit
End If
Next cell
End Sub
运行此宏后,Excel将根据每个单元格的内容自动调整行高。这种方法适用于需要批量处理的情况。
2、根据单元格内容动态调整
你也可以根据单元格内容的字符数来动态调整行高。例如,对于需要根据文本长度调整行高的场景,可以使用以下VBA代码:
Sub AdjustRowHeightBasedOnContent()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im cell As Range
For Each cell In ws.UsedRange
If Len(cell.Value) > 20 Then '假设超过20个字符的单元格需要调整行高
cell.EntireRow.RowHeight = 30 '设置行高为30
Else
cell.EntireRow.RowHeight = 15 '设置行高为15
End If
Next cell
End Sub
运行此宏后,Excel将根据每个单元格的字符数调整行高,确保内容能够完全显示。
四、调整行高的最佳实践
1、根据内容类型选择合适的方法
对于纯文本内容,使用自动调整功能通常最为便捷;对于特定格式的表格或需要统一行高的情况,手动设置固定行高更为合适;对于复杂的动态调整需求,使用VBA宏则能够提供更大的灵活性。
2、注意Excel版本的差异
不同版本的Excel在功能和界面上可能有所不同,本文所述方法基于最新版本的Excel。如果你使用的是较旧版本,某些功能和菜单选项可能会有所不同,请参考对应版本的帮助文档。
3、定期检查和调整
在编辑和更新Excel表格的过程中,内容可能会发生变化,导致原有的行高设置不再适用。因此,建议定期检查和调整行高,确保表格的可读性和美观性。
4、使用格式刷快速应用行高设置
如果你已经为某些行设置了合适的行高,可以使用格式刷快速将相同的行高设置应用到其他行。选择已设置好行高的行,点击格式刷图标,然后选择需要应用相同行高的行即可。
总之,Excel表格中的行高调整是确保表格内容清晰可见的重要步骤。通过掌握和应用以上方法,你可以更高效地管理和美化你的Excel表格,提高工作效率和数据展示效果。
相关问答FAQs:
Q: 如何在Excel表格中自动调整行高?
A: 在Excel表格中自动调整行高非常简单。您可以按照以下步骤进行操作:
- 选中您希望自动调整行高的行或整个表格。
- 在Excel菜单栏中找到“格式”选项,并点击“行高”。
- 在弹出的对话框中,选择“自动调整行高”选项。
- 点击“确定”按钮,Excel将自动根据单元格内容的大小调整行高。
Q: 如何手动调整Excel表格的行高?
A: 如果您希望手动调整Excel表格的行高,您可以按照以下步骤进行操作:
- 选中您希望调整行高的行或整个表格。
- 将鼠标悬停在选中的行的边界上,直到光标变为双向箭头。
- 按住鼠标左键并拖动行的边界,即可调整行高。
- 松开鼠标左键时,Excel将根据您拖动的距离来调整行高。
Q: Excel表格中如何设置特定行的固定行高?
A: 如果您希望设置Excel表格中特定行的固定行高,您可以按照以下步骤进行操作:
- 选中您希望设置固定行高的行或整个表格。
- 在Excel菜单栏中找到“格式”选项,并点击“行高”。
- 在弹出的对话框中,输入您希望设置的固定行高数值(以磅为单位)。
- 点击“确定”按钮,Excel将会将所选行的行高固定为您输入的数值。
希望以上解答能够帮助到您。如果您还有其他问题,请随时向我提问。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4111247